Off-site run checklist, item 7 — Payslips for the Gorsebank satellite site. The Gorsebank cabin has no printer, so payroll has produced sealed paper payslips for all eleven staff there. Collect the sealed envelope bundle from the payroll cabinet, confirm the count against the enclosed tally slip, and sign the custody log before leaving. Envelopes must stay in the tamper-evident pouch for the whole journey; no roadside stops with the pouch unattended. At the gate, the courier hands over only after receiving the line below.

dispatch memo: the lamwyn fenwyn courier leaves the wenir ledger at gate 7175 under passcode 822969

- [ ] **Step 7: Breaker override escrow.** After sealing the signing keys for the Tallgrove upstream API circuit breaker, confirm the support team can force the breaker open during a full outage. The override bundle lives in the sealed escrow drawer and is useless without its unlock phrase. Two ceremony witnesses must initial this step before proceeding. The escrow bundle is decrypted with the recovery passphrase that follows.

vault phrase of kahip-kahop = holath-quenmir

For this week's sync: the Queryhaven GraphQL layer previously issued one lookup per node when resolving the `collaborators` field, producing the N+1 storm Dalia flagged in staging. The fix batches resolution through the Loaderbee cache and shipped through our attested Millbright pipeline, so the artifact's origin, builder, and source commit are all verifiable. Please confirm your environments run the remediated build rather than a pre-fix canary before closing related tickets. The attestation token for the fixed release appears below.

pipeline stamp: htk9_6ce9d33c5

Handover Note — from Priya Dellmont to the incoming director, Northgate Fixtures. Welcome aboard. The thing to watch is Ralsten Marine: they're 55% of our order book and they know it. Pricing pressure has been constant, and their procurement lead enjoys brinkmanship. I've started quiet conversations with three smaller yards to spread the risk — details in the deal tracker. Don't let the team panic; the account is stable through spring. Read the confidential note below before your first Ralsten meeting.

confidential, kagup-bafog: Fraaxax Group is in early talks to buy Soroxox Group for about $343.8 million. The Olidor launch date is June 14, and nothing goes to the press before then. Legal wants the Aldmirek Logistics term sheet signed before July 23.